“They didn’t want to understand, but I’m not interested,” – the head of the Church of Cyprus on the Synod’s opinion on the OCU

The Primate of the Orthodox Church of Cyprus, Archbishop Chrysostom, said that he was not interested in the opinion of the members of the Holy Synod on the OCU issue. The website Romfea quotes the words of the head of the Church of Cyprus.

When asked to comment on the situation with his recognition of the OCU, which many members of the Synod do not accept, the Cypriot primate said: “The Russians are wrong.”

“I explained to them, they didn’t want to understand. I am not interested,” the Archbishop explained his attitude to the opinion of the synodals.
